Main Cruise Ship Ports in Iceland
Iceland has several major ports where cruise ships dock, offering easy access to some of the country’s most beautiful landscapes and exciting shore excursions. Here are the main cruise ports in Iceland:
-
The Two Reykjavik Ports - The capital of Iceland has two main ports for cruise ships: Skarfabakki and the Old Reykjavik Harbor. Both offer easy access to the city and its surroundings.
- Sundahofn Port is the larger of the two and is located just a short distance from the city center. It’s the main port for many international cruises, where most ships dock at the "Skarfabakki" terminal. You'll find plenty of tours offering pick-up from this area, making it easy to see popular sights like the Golden Circle, Reykjavik city tours, and other nearby attractions.
- Old Harbor is a smaller, more picturesque port located in the heart of Reykjavik. It’s surrounded by colorful buildings, restaurants, and shops. From here, you can easily explore the city on foot or take a tour to places like the Blue Lagoon or the South Coast.
- Akureyri Harbor - Located in North Iceland, Akureyri Harbor is Iceland’s second-largest port. It’s in the beautiful Eyjafjordur fjord, surrounded by towering mountains, and offers easy access to a range of exciting shore excursions. From Akureyri, you can take tours to nearby attractions like the Godafoss waterfall, Lake Myvatn, and the Diamond Circle, a route that includes stunning sights such as the Dettifoss waterfall and the Asbyrgi canyon.
- Isafjordur Harbor - This town is located in the remote Westfjords of Iceland, offering a unique stop for travelers seeking an off-the-beaten-path experience. Isafjordur is surrounded by dramatic mountain scenery and deep fjords, and is an excellent base for exploring the Westfjords. Shore excursions from Isafjordur include hikes, wildlife tours, and visits to historical sites and natural wonders, like the Dynjandi waterfall.

Best Hot Springs to Visit on a Shore Excursion
If there's one experience that can't be missed when visiting Iceland, it's bathing in hot springs and geothermal lagoons. Iceland is famous for its bathing culture, and there are many amazing locations to visit on a shore excursion.
- Soak in the Blue Lagoon: The Blue Lagoon is one of Iceland's most iconic geothermal spas. Its milky blue waters are rich in minerals, providing a luxurious and relaxing experience. Combining admission with this Blue Lagoon transfer from Reykjavik with optional harbor pickup makes this an easy addition to your shore excursion itinerary.
- Relax at the Sky Lagoon: Just minutes from Reykjavik, the Sky Lagoon offers a modern, upscale spa experience. Enjoy its infinity pool overlooking the Atlantic Ocean and complete your visit with the seven-step Ritual, a rejuvenating spa treatment. This admission includes a Reykjavik transfer with harbor pickup, making it a convenient and hassle-free shore excursion.
- Enjoy nature at the Hvammsvik Hot Springs: Nestled in a peaceful fjord a 40-minute drive from Reykjavik, these natural hot springs are surrounded by incredible views of Icelandic nature. The facility blends into its surroundings, creating a unique and peaceful atmosphere. This experience includes an admission ticket and transfer from Reykjavik, with an option to add a harbor pickup.
- Take in the views at the Forest Lagoon: This geothermal spa in North Iceland is a must-have experience in Akureyri, offering breathtaking views of the surrounding fjord. You can catch a free transfer from Hotel Kea, located on Akureyri’s main street. You don't need to pre-book, but if you've already purchased your Forest Lagoon ticket, you'll have priority boarding on the bus. This makes it easy to explore the town and enjoy a relaxing soak before returning to your ship.
